VT HCR197

House concurrent resolution congratulating the YMCA on its 175th anniversary and extending best wishes for the organization’s future endeavors

Passed House Barbara Rachelson (D)
Plain English Summary

The bill, VT HCR197, is a resolution that congratulates the YMCA on reaching its 175th anniversary. It also expresses good wishes for the organization's future efforts and contributions to the community.
